In this section, we will discuss another special type of wire that we use, which is called enameled copper wire, which is a wire coated with a very thin layer of insulating material. This insulation consists of materials that can withstand the high temperatures that electricity can generate. Enameled copper wire is very commonly used in various electronic applications, such as motors, transformers, solenoids (devices for generating magnetic field). 32 AWG enameled copper wire is one of the most common, and useful types of wire among all these sizes. We will discuss what makes 32 AWG enameled copper wire precious and why it is the best option for multiple electronics related solutions.
First, what does AWG mean? American Wire Gauge (AWG) It is a measuring system that indicates how thick or thin a wire is. An AWG number identifies wire thickness — with lower numbers indicating a thicker wire. Hence when we refer to 32 AWG enameled copper wire, we refer to a very thin wire that has a diameter of 0.008 inches (0.203 mm). Electric conductivity is the most important feature of 32 AWG enameled copper wire. Copper is one of the best conductors for carrying electrical signals. That number means that it is able to easily transport electricity from one location to another, with minimal energy loss in the process. Nevertheless, conventional copper wire is generally covered by an insulating layer that may reduce its conductivity. Enamelled copper wire developed this invention by covering the wire with a thin special insulation layer which does not block its conductivity. Being extremely thin (32 AWG) the wire can be coiled tightly. It also helps maximize its ability to conduct electricity while keeping its size small, very important in many electronic devices.

So, let's get to know why 32 AWG enameled copper wire suits for electronic devices. First off, its thinness and efficient conductivity mean that it is well suited to applications with limited space but a need for high performance. In small motors, for example, the wire needs to occupy very small volumes yet deliver sufficient power for the whole assembly to work. This same wire comes in handy in solenoids where it must produce a strong magnetic field without overheating that would lead to a problem.

The insulating provides protection to the wire from environment factors, which could have caused damage/rust to inside copper, which is another great reason to use this type of wire. That insulation means that the wire is easy to work with and can easily be wound into coils without breaking or losing its shape. Another pro is that 32 AWG enameled copper wire is easy to solder. Soldering is a method of connecting wires to other components, and with this wire, you don’t even need any special tools or techniques to do it well.
